Spotify sidelines music downloads store

Tom Pakinkis

Spotify appears to have sidelined its music download store, according to reports.

The service (which is primarily a streaming platform) now displays a notification which reads “We’re currently not supporting new download purchases on Spotify” when purchases of tracks via its desktop client are attempted.

Users who have already bought download bundles can still use up any remaining credit to buy tracks.
